pub struct ServiceUnit {
pub kind: &'static str,
pub path: PathBuf,
pub text: String,
pub install_command: String,
}Expand description
A rendered service unit: what setup prints and writes.
Fields§
§kind: &'static strlaunchd or systemd.
path: PathBufWhere setup writes the rendered text under <home>/service/.
text: StringThe unit text itself.
install_command: StringThe command an operator (or ORC-10) runs to install it.
